The Transformative Power of Gratitude

When we embrace a life of thanksgiving, we open ourselves to a multitude of benefits. Scientific studies have consistently shown that gratitude positively impacts both mental and physical health. It reduces stress, fosters resilience, improves sleep, and enhances overall happiness. Grateful individuals tend to be more empathetic, compassionate, and have stronger relationships with others.

Living a life of thanksgiving isn’t about denying challenges or hardships. Instead, it’s about acknowledging these difficulties while actively seeking out the lessons, opportunities, and moments of joy that exist within them. It’s a conscious choice to focus on the positive aspects of our lives, no matter how small they might seem.

Cultivating an Attitude of Gratitude

Practicing gratitude is a skill that can be cultivated and nurtured. It begins with mindfulness—a deliberate effort to be present in each moment and acknowledge the goodness in our lives. Here are some ways to incorporate gratitude into our daily routine:

Keep a Gratitude Journal:

Maintaining a gratitude journal can be a powerful tool. Taking a few minutes each day to jot down things we’re thankful for helps us recognize and appreciate the abundance in our lives.

Express Appreciation:

Don’t hesitate to express gratitude to others. Saying “thank you,” writing notes of appreciation, or simply acknowledging someone’s contribution can create a ripple effect of positivity.

Focus on the Present:

Practice mindfulness by being fully present in the current moment. Pay attention to the simple joys that often go unnoticed, such as the warmth of the sun, the laughter of loved ones, or the beauty of nature.

Serve and Give Back:

Engage in acts of kindness and service. Contributing to the well-being of others not only benefits them but also brings a deep sense of fulfillment and gratitude to ourselves.
